Default LCC, MMP, Novak 21.5 motor question

This question is more geared towards the Novak motor.. I did some searching but didn't really find the answer I wanted..

I'm running an LCC with the new worms, MMP, 3s, Novak Ballistic 21.5 crawler motor 14t pinion.

I've be running Losi mtrs and made the switch this last week.. Got a chance to run it on the rocks this weekend and have some questions on the timing..

The other brushless mtrs I've had did not have any timing marks. The Novak comes set to 30 degrees.. I noticed with the LCC that it had more speed in reverse than forward.. I moved the timing to where the speed was about the same, or maybe a bit faster forward.. This brings the timing up close to 45 degrees. Running it this weekend the motor got hotter than I would like and seem to go through batteries quicker..

I'd like to get the timing closer to 0 for more torque (and probably less heat) but the wheel speed decreases quite a bit.. I can also use the cheat mode on the MMP, but I'm not sure it will bring back the needed wheelspeed without getting crazy on the advance.

I'm contemplating swapping the tranny around, but that brings in another whole can of worms like mounting the dig servo and battery..

IF... I time the motor closer to 0 how much timing with cheat mode do I need to use (and be safe) and at what RPM range should I kick it in..

I set my cheat to 30* at 16000-18000 rpm and I run 4s. With your 3s I would say try starting at 12000-14000 and see what you think or you could go 4s. It's all personal preference with the cheat I've seen a big variety of settings. I also noticed the forward/reverse thing you mentioned I set my end points on my radio at 115 forward 150 reverse (thats on a dx3r).
